Context Readings

An Invasion From The North

6 Lift up the signal of Zion: save ye by flight, ye shall not stand: for I bring evil from the north, and a great breaking. 7 The lion came up from his thicket, and destroying, he broke up the nations; he went forth from his place to set thy land for a desolation; thy cities shall be laid waste from none inhabiting. 8 For this, be ye girded with sackcloth, lament and wail: for the heat of the anger of Jehovah turned not back from us.
